As a BCBA with CSH, you'll work closely with families, supervise team members, and guide clinical care across your cases. As a BCBA you will also work under the supervision of the Clinical Director and/or the Senior Clinical Supervisor. BCBAs are also responsible for developing and implementing Behavior Intervention Plans, supporting the implementation of ABA (Applied Behavior Analysis) therapy programs across the home, center and/or community settings, and is responsible for supervising the Behavior Technicians (BT's) as well as providing consistent parent/caregiver training and case oversight.
Your responsibilities will include:
Providing clinical oversight across assigned cases. Oversee, supervise, train, and mentor, our amazing case managers and behavior therapists. Ensuring programs are being implemented and run correctly and consistently. Ensuring progress is being made across programs and families are satisfied with progress. Conducting functional behavior assessments and developing behavior strategies to teach replacement behaviors, reduce maladaptive behaviors, and develop treatment goals to address each concern, domain, and skill deficit. Assisting in the development of and facilitating training in Applied Behavior Analysis using numerous models of training. Completing mandatory clinical session notes on time Maintaining HIPAA (Health Insurance Portability and Accountability Act) confidentiality. Attending monthly management meetings to keep up on industry trends and training. Ensuring the electronic data collections system (Catalyst- now known as Ensora) is updated to correspond with the most recent progress report. Remaining proficient with policies and procedures. Representing the company professionally in all client and colleague interactions.
